Cutting Tool Tool Performance: Elements & Optimal Techniques
Achieving superior bit performance relies on considering several critical variables. Part type, spindle RPM, DOC, feed rate, cutting fluid application, and tool shape all significantly influence results. To improve tool longevity and cut quality, follow proven techniques: use the appropriate end mill variety for the job, ensure stable settings, apply efficient fluid strategies, and frequently check tool state. Finally, thorough maintenance is crucial for delivering accurate components.
